TO CLOSE Facing his sternest test to date, the lightly-raced four- year-old proved up to the task when he scampered clear Historical Zandvliet Stud, the birthplace of the legendary of Tommy Hotspur winner Moofeed (Duke Of Pocket Power , will close its doors after more than a Marmalade ) at the furlong mark to score by the best part century as a leading breeding concern. of two lengths. An part of the South African racing and breeding The winner first gave notice of his ability when third in a landscape since 1870, the De Wet family’s Ashton-based wine and horse farm was recently sold and as the new three-way finish to last season’s Gr.3 Man O’War Stakes, owners do not intend continuing the breeding operation, after which he was side-lined for all of eight months. He is the stud will cease to exist, although the family will stay on fast making up for lost time though, this being his third win the farm until the end of August. on the bounce and with relatively little mileage on the It was while under the care of Paulie de Wet, father of clock - this was only his eighth outing – the gelding now current incumbents Paul and Dan, that Zandvliet became heads to the Gr.1 Computaform Sprint at the end of the an icon, not just for its superlative Shiraz wine, but also for month. the wonderful which were born and raised He is the latest Stakes winner for Var , sire also of last in its paddocks. year’s winner Happy Forever . Under Paulie’s watch, the stud was home to ’s Dollar Dazzler was bred at Klipdrif Stud and was raised son Noble Chieftain , three times the country’s Champion by the Stakes-placed Joshua Dancer mare Isla Bonita , a sire as well as a leading broodmare sire and of Derby third full-sister to Gr.3-placed nine-time winner Jumpin Double Eclipse , who subsequently was sold to America. Joshua . A master salesman and a man of vision, Paulie was a TZIGANE GRABS SYCAMORE SPOILS regular buyer of breeding stock at the Newmarket sales and his imports during the fifties and sixties went on to Tzigane took no prisoners when she scored a career best establish some of the farm’s important foundation first Stakes victory in Turffontein’s Gr.3 Sycamore Sprint, families. Amongst the many high-class gallopers he bred restricted to fillies and mares. were winners of the Queen’s Plate, Summer Cup, Gold The Barend Botes-trained mare entered this race under Cup and . Ironically, he missed out on a the radar but unleashed a powerful charge from the rear to coveted Durban July winner, having sold Tivoli , a flash home from last year’s third Virgo’s Babe (Malhub ). daughter of the imported Miazzina , when she was This was a top-drawer performance from the five-year- carrying 1981 winner Beau Art ! old, considering she was stone last going through the When Paulie passed away in 2000, son Dan took over the 600m mark. The mare’s success considerably enhanced reins and he has proved himself a more than worthy her paddock value, albeit that she already boasted small successor, his crowning the incomparable black-type, courtesy of a second in the Listed Gardenia Pocket Power, who became the stud’s first July winner Handicap earlier this season. when sharing the honours with Dancer’s Daughter in 2008.  LAKE GE NEVA’S SISTER  TOPS FINAL DAY While there were no falling branches today, it was records which fell on the final day of selling at the Inglis Sydney Easter Yearling Sale. It was a day with only one further Lot 409 , a filly by Redoute’s Choice , who was bought seven-figure lot, making ten for the three day sale. In all by Shadwell Australia for A$920,000 session 1 of the sale was a huge success, recording an incredible gross of A$102,110,000, up from A$83,269,250 twelve months ago. The average also rose, from Stakes winner Hips Don’t Lie (Stravinsky ), consigned by A$250,059 to A$291,743 and the median from A$180,000 Coolmore and bought by Victoria-based trainer John to A$200,000, putting a seal on what has been an Sadler on behalf of Aquanita Racing for A$1,000,000. The exceptionally strong yearling sales season across the price matched that paid for a full relation to this filly last board in Australia. Session II did not disappoint either, year, who has since gone on to become Lake Geneva , setting a new record average and gross since being third in both the Gr.1 Blue Diamond Stakes and the Gr.1 introduced in 2009. 96 lots were sold yesterday at an Golden Slipper and entered in the Gr.3 Percy Sykes Stakes average of A$94,641, resulting in the record gross of on Saturday. A$9,085,500. “ As stated throughout the Inglis Easter Second in line was the A$920,000 paid by Angus Gold of marketing campaign, a lot goes into realising a champion, Shadwell Australia for Lot 409 , a Redoute’s Choice filly but it is thanks to our skillful breeders and vendors that out of the Gr.1 Manawatu Sires’ Produce Stakes runner-up some are certainly born great. We are delighted that sale Fleur De’Here (Dehere ), consigned by Newgate Farm. ring greatness was achieved here this week ,” said Inglis’ The filly’s dam is a half-sister to the Gr.1 South Australian Managing Director Mark Webster. “ The strength of the Tully Thunder Thunder Gulch buying bench and the catalogue assembled has resulted Oaks winner ( ) as well as in a Session I gross of over $100 million and record results the Stakes winner and sire Sufficient (Zabeel ), from the from the growing second session ,” Webster said. family of the Gr.2 Wakeful Stakes winner and Gr.1 Oaks- The sole seven-figure lot on day three came with Lot second Thunder Lady ( ), who runs in 437 , a daughter of Fastnet Rock and the Gr.2 Reisling the Gr.1 Australian Oaks on Saturday. Shadwell Stud also secured the highest-priced yearling in Session II, paying A$500,000 for Lot 504 , a colt by Snitzel out of Appear (Danzero ), who hails from the family of the Champion Older Horse and multiple Gr.1 winner Grand Armee (Hennessy ), the Gr.1 Oakleigh Plate winner Drum (Marauding ) and the Gr.1 Australasian Oaks winner Anamato (Redoute’s Choice ), from Newhaven Park. Along with those yearlings, Shadwell were the busiest individual buyer at Easter for the third consecutive year, purchasing 19 yearlings for a total outlay of A$6,615,000 across the three days of selling. London, , Marketing Executive Great British Racing International Great British Racing International (GBRI) is looking for an enthusiastic and innovative Marketing Executive to join their small and dynamic team. GBRI was set up to maintain and grow international investment in one of the world’s leading luxury goods, British Horseracing. As the gateway to this pursuit, GBRI’s purpose is to showcase the values of British horseracing to an international audience and translate interest into economic activity.

As a Marketing Executive for GBRI, you will hit the ground running taking responsibility for core sectors of GBRI’s marketing strategy, specifically related to branding, digital marketing, collateral production and CRM management. The Marketing Executive will be responsible for the implementation and administration of GBRI’s key marketing campaigns, including Team British Racing and the International Members Club.
